Ordinals
beta
Address bc1qfqkpelqwmh9txzqkcdpfh3fkk6exl43jyx5vdt
sat balance
29862
outputs
3cc76d861e4c9dc43724ac752b31144b093db95b99815ee8e58f5bf2097b9c20:0